micky wrote:
OT probably.

I'm looking into Roku and I see there is the Roku Channel Store.

I gather one has to have channels to watch anything.


YES

But because I don't have a userid and password, I couldn't get to the
place in the Store where it might ask for money.


http://www.rokuguide.com/channels

Do all the channels cost money?


No

Or only the ones I know cost money, like Netflix?

Does it cost to have Youtube as a channel, or Hulu?


Youtube, no; Hulu+, yes ($7.99/month)

And is it possible to just watch a video that someone puts on his own
website. Like if he has webspace nad he puts up my cousin's wedding.
Can I watch that with Roku? For free?


If he has created a channel, you can subscribe to it and watch whatever is
on it.

What do I use to type in the URL for these things?


What things? Channels? You don't type in anything, just click the icon once
you subscribe. Once the channel loads, you can search it. You can search
generically - cross channel - from one of Roku's main screens.

Even youtube, which I've read can be played, has to have a topic to
search for or an id to to play, something has to be typed in, because
their list of videos is in the milliions, I think. Scrolling is out
of the question.

I'm a babe in the woods here.


I just want to get out of this not so comfortable desk chair and watch
more stuff on the TV instead of the computer screen.


Buy the model 2 Roku

We subscibe to two pay channels...Netflix and Acorn. Netflix is $7.99/month
plus $1.00 for each additional user if they want to be able to watch
diferent channels at the same time. Acorn is $4-5 month. No commercials on
either. Hulu+ is $7.99, you get commercials. There are many free channels,
some feed commercials, others do not.
